An “Israeli” soldier was killed in a Hezbollah drone attack on the Western Galilee this Monday morning.

The soldier is identified as Chief Warrant Officer Mahmood Amaria, 45 years old, a tracker in the 300th “Baram” Regional Brigade – per a statement by the Israeli Occupation Forces (IOF).

Five explosive-laden drones were launched from Lebanon in the attack, with three being intercepted by the Iron Dome air defense system – according to the IOF.

Two of the drones struck the Western Galilee.

The drone that struck near Ya’ara killed the one soldier and injured several others, including one with “serious” injuries.

Hezbollah later took responsibility for the attack in a statement, saying it targeted an “Israeli” military position.
